Securing transactions, hunting down rogue organizations or banning cold calling: since the start of the school year, the government and the majority have been firing on all cylinders to protect the 40 million beneficiaries of a personal training account. A new regulatory measure is in preparation, but in a much less favorable direction for those concerned, according to our information. Under the guise of promoting professional integration but also (or above all) of reducing expenses, it would be a question of applying a remainder to be paid on each purchase of training.

“A reflection is actually underway on the participation of the user in the management of part of his training for regulatory purposes”, confirms a spokesperson for the Minister of Vocational Training and Education , Carole Grandjean. No rate or quantification has however been “discussed or agreed” with the social partners or the representatives of the training organizations, she adds.
